换工作的关系,已经有一段时间没有接触GIT了。新公司做开发的人不多,因此前期都未使用版本控制工具。最近项目快到尾期,需要对之前的代码进行整理,并发布版本。由于之前接触过GIT,因此又再学习了一些GIT的知识。
windows平台git的使用
主要工具:msysgit tortoiseGit。网上有许多相关的安装和配置教材。这里就不再赘述。
msysgit: Git的核心功能
tortoiseGit: 类似于SVN的版本控制工具,提供了强大的git扩展。其运行基于msysgit。
一些简单的版本控制命令,可以参考之前的文章:git的简单使用
这里主要对协同开发做一个简单介绍。
远端新建一个空白仓库
git init --bare
将本地代码Push到远端
git remote add origin "URL" <<将 URL 配置为本地仓库的远端, 命名为origin
git push -u origin master <<将代码push到远端(origin)的master分支
删除remote
git remote rm origin <<删除命名为origin 的远端
克隆远端代码
git clone URL name <<克隆URL上的代码,并命名为name